What to Evaluate When Reviewing an NFT Project
Before committing resources, establish a systematic evaluation framework. Key elements to assess include:
Tokenomics & Distribution: How are tokens or NFTs distributed among founders, community, and future sales?
Community Value Proposition: What tangible benefits do holders receive?
Access & Utility: Do NFTs grant specific rights, exclusive experiences, or governance participation?
Documentation Quality: Examine whitepaper clarity, smart contract audits, and terms of service
Governance Structure: How are project decisions made and who has decision-making power?
Technical Infrastructure: Review smart contracts and blockchain verification details
Communication Channels: Find official social media links and community gathering spaces
Project Transparency: Monitor announcements regarding technical upgrades, partnerships, and milestones
This information typically lives across multiple platforms including on-chain explorers, dedicated NFT tracking websites, and community forums on Discord and Telegram. However, always verify information comes from official channels rather than secondary sources.
Eight Essential Methods for Finding NFT Projects
1. Social Media Monitoring (Twitter)
Twitter has become the primary hub for NFT project announcements and community discussion. Many creators actively share collections and development updates on the platform.
Create curated lists of projects and thought leaders you follow to organize information flow. External links found on Twitter often direct you to official websites, community Discord servers, and detailed roadmaps. However, exercise extreme caution—verify link authenticity before clicking, as phishing attempts are common.
Follow established creators, collectors, and industry analysts whose judgment aligns with your investment criteria. This approach exposes you to emerging projects while building knowledge through community engagement.
2. Discord Community Engagement
Discord servers dedicated to NFTs provide both official project updates and peer discussion. Quality community engagement—reflected in thoughtful conversations and consistent activity—often indicates a healthy project ecosystem.
Official project Discord channels share whitelist opportunities, mint schedules, technical updates, and governance decisions. These spaces also reveal community sentiment and long-term commitment from team members.
Joining multiple Discord communities helps you compare project quality, understand community standards, and build networks with fellow collectors.
3. Rarity Analysis Tools
Understanding NFT rarity is fundamental to valuation. Rarity determines perceived market value—generally, scarcer attributes command premium prices and resale potential.
Dedicated rarity tools calculate rarity scores by analyzing trait frequency across collections. These platforms allow you to identify undervalued NFTs, discover emerging collections, and compare relative scarcity.
Most rarity tools specialize in specific blockchains, so research tools compatible with chains you’re interested in.
4. Analytics & Tracking Platforms
Real-time analytics tools provide market insights including active mint activity, trending collections, trading patterns, and price movements. These metrics help optimize entry and exit timing based on whale activity, sales trends, and historical price data.
Advanced platforms offer multi-chain tracking capabilities, allowing you to monitor opportunities across different blockchains simultaneously. Check ranking pages to view current market leaders, recent trading activity, and price history.
5. NFT Calendar Resources
Dedicated NFT calendars compile upcoming drops, completed launches, and ongoing projects. These calendars help you discover projects at early stages before mainstream adoption.
Drops from recognized artists, influential creators, and established celebrities typically attract serious collectors and demonstrate longer-term potential compared to anonymous creators.
Locate these calendars through simple Google searches or community recommendations in NFT-focused Discord and Telegram channels.
6. NFT Alpha Communities
Alpha groups—typically private Discord servers—offer members curated project information, whitelist access, and early development insights. Some operate as public communities while others require membership fees or token holdings.
These groups serve as information hubs where members share discoveries and analyze opportunities collectively. However, approach groups offering “exclusive tips for a fee” with significant skepticism, as these often lack legitimate value.
7. Industry Publications & Newsletters
Regular newsletters from established NFT analysts and media outlets provide curated project updates and market analysis. Subscribing to quality sources keeps you informed about developments while potentially granting early access to launches.
These newsletters often include comparative analysis and market commentary, supporting more informed decision-making.
8. In-Person Networking Events
Conferences and community events create opportunities to connect with fellow collectors, developers, and project teams. Real conversations can reveal project authenticity and team commitment more effectively than online research alone.
These gatherings sometimes catalyze formation of personal alpha groups with trusted peers, creating shared information networks.
Building Your Research Practice
Successful NFT discovery depends on combining multiple research channels rather than relying on single sources. Develop a personal checklist of evaluation criteria aligned with your investment philosophy.
Cross-reference information across platforms—what you find on Twitter should be verified through official Discord announcements and smart contract verification. This triangulation approach reduces risk of falling victim to scams or poorly conceived projects.
Remember that thousands of new NFT projects launch regularly, and many lack competent teams or genuine utility. Personal intuition combined with systematic analysis provides your strongest defense against poor decisions.
